Frequently asked questions on Buying a Driver's License in France1. Is it legal to buy a chauffeur's license in France?
No, it is prohibited to purchase a chauffeur's license in France. This act is considered scams.
2. What are the implications if I get caught?
Getting captured can lead to fines, criminal charges, and the cancellation of the fraudulent license. In severe cases, one could deal with jail time.
3. For how long does it take to get a legal motorist's license in France?
The timeframe differs, however it normally takes numerous months to complete both the theory and practical examinations.
4. What files are required to request a motorist's license?
Frequently needed files consist of proof of identity, residency, a medical certificate, and evidence of conclusion of a theoretical course or passing the theory exam.
5. Can immigrants obtain a French driver's license?
Yes, foreigners can obtain a French driver's license, however they must satisfy particular requirements, including residency and in some cases, language efficiency.
6. Are there any exceptions at the same time?
Yes, there are exemptions for EU people who are enabled to exchange their license for a French one without undergoing tests.
